Julian LeFay, Father of the Elder Scrolls, Has Passed Away
Julian LeFay, known in the gaming world as the man who laid the foundations for the Elder Scrolls series, passed away on July 22, 2025, at the age of 59. Silence in the Gaming World After Julian LeFay
Julian LeFay joined Bethesda in its early years and etched his name in gaming history with the first Elder Scrolls games, Arena and Daggerfall. He made such a profound impact that one of the gods in the Elder Scrolls universe, “Julianos,” was named after him. He later founded OnceLost Games with former Bethesda developers Ted Peterson and Vijay Lakshman and began work on a new role-playing game called The Wayward Realms.
It was announced last week that LeFay had retired from active duty. According to CEO Peterson, LeFay chose to spend his final moments peacefully with his family. Despite this, even during his illness, he continued to inspire the development team and share his vision. In its announcement, OnceLost Games emphasized that his guidance continues to shape their projects.
The studio stated that Julian LeFay was “a figure who encouraged countless developers in the gaming world and pushed them to push creative boundaries.” Furthermore, they stated that his contribution was not limited to their own teams but was reflected in the stories, universes, and moments experienced by millions of players. Therefore, The Wayward Realms project will be completed in his honor.
